Deposit Limits: The Only Safety Net You Have

Here is my rule. I set a deposit limit before I even open a game. Most of the big Aussie-friendly casinos let you do this in your account settings. I set mine at $200 per week. That is it. If I lose $200, I am done for the week.

You might think, “But what if I am on a hot streak?” That is exactly when you need the limit. When you are winning, your brain releases dopamine. You feel invincible. You will start chasing bigger bets. The deposit limit stops you from giving back all your winnings plus your own money.

I always advise Aussie players to set a daily, weekly, and monthly limit. Do not just set one. Set all three. The daily limit stops a bad night. The weekly limit stops a bad week. The monthly limit stops a bad month. It is a triple lock.

Self-Exclusion: The Nuclear Option

I have used self-exclusion twice in my life. Once when I was chasing losses on a particularly bad pokie. Once when I just felt the habit was getting out of hand.

Do not be ashamed of self-exclusion. It is a tool. Most licensed casinos offer it under the “Responsible Gambling” section. You can exclude yourself for 6 months, 1 year, or permanently.

Here is the trick: if you self-exclude from one casino, do it for all of them. I use a service called GamStop (if you are in the UK) or BetStop (for Aussie players). It blocks you from every licensed site in the country. It is brutal. But it works.

If you feel like you are losing control, do not wait. Self-exclude today. The money will still be there tomorrow. Your mental health is worth more than any jackpot.

Reality Checks: The Annoying Friend You Need

I have reality checks set to go off every 15 minutes. Yes, it is annoying. A pop-up appears on my screen that says, “You have been playing for 15 minutes. Do you want to continue?”

I hate that pop-up. But it has saved me hundreds of dollars.

When you are deep in a game, you lose track of time. You think you have been playing for 30 minutes, but it has been 3 hours. The reality check breaks that trance. It gives you a moment to think. “Do I really want to keep playing?”

Most of the time, I click “Continue.” But sometimes, I stop. And that one stop can save you from a massive loss.

Set your reality check to 10 minutes. Not 30. Not 60. 10 minutes is short enough to keep you grounded but long enough to not ruin the fun completely.

The Trap of “Progressive Jackpots”

I have a love-hate relationship with progressive jackpots. On one hand, the idea of winning $1 million from a single spin is intoxicating. On the other hand, the odds are astronomically against you.

Here is the math. A typical progressive jackpot pokie has an RTP of 88% to 92%. That means for every $100 you bet, the casino keeps $8 to $12. Over time, you will lose. The only winner is the person who hits the jackpot. And that person is almost never you.

I still play progressives, but I have a strict rule. I only bet $1 per spin. I never chase the jackpot. I treat it like a lottery ticket. If I win, great. If I lose, I am out $1.

Do not fall for the “Hot Drop” jackpots either. Those are designed to make you think the jackpot is “due.” It is not. The RNG is random. The jackpot is not due. It is just a marketing trick.

KYC: The Boring but Necessary Step

I hate KYC (Know Your Customer). It is annoying. You have to upload your ID, a utility bill, and sometimes a selfie holding your ID. But it is necessary.

Why? Because if you do not complete KYC, you cannot withdraw. I have seen players win $5,000 and then get stuck because they refused to upload their ID. The casino keeps the money.

Do it as soon as you register. Upload your driver’s license and a recent bill. It takes 10 minutes. Then, when you win, you can withdraw immediately.

Some casinos, like PlayOJO, have “no wagering” requirements on their bonuses. That means you can withdraw your winnings immediately after the bonus spins. But you still need KYC. Do not skip it.
